myOSA for Teeth Grinders
Teeth grinding, or bruxing, is another common symptom associated with Sleep Disordered Breathing and is often caused by mouth breathing then exacerbated by stress or nervous tension. This bruxing can cause damage to the teeth including visible enamel wearing, tooth cracking or excessive tooth mobility. While the entire myOSA® appliance range will offer some protection against the damage caused by bruxing, the myOSA for Teeth Grinders™ is designed specifically for this purpose and provides a protective barrier between the teeth. Intended to wear with use, these appliances can be easily replaced to prevent damage to the dentition.
